This study analysed changes in indoor air quality through wood finishing remodelling based on the results of indoor air quality measurement for Lab Scale-test and two educational facilities, and evaluated the contribution to carbon dioxide reduction using the ECO2 program. In order to expand the use of domestic wood for the realization of a carbon-neutral society and to improve the living environment, it is necessary to prepare guidelines for the indoor wood finishing modeling project and to quantitatively verify its effectiveness. © 2022 17th International Conference on Indoor Air Quality and Climate, INDOOR AIR 2022.
